Police Community Support Officers are to become the "first line of contact" for members of the public and rebranded as local beat officers, under proposals being considered today by South Yorkshire Police Authority.
Regular officers will be grouped into "taskable teams" available for dealing with serious incidents while all grassroots work on the street will be carried out by the PCSOs.
